Transaction 76754123725ed883f3a6dff7ede48bd71691c801f6f9b64289c105f1c5e74804

2 Input
2 Outputs
  • 76754123725ed883f3a6dff7ede48bd71691c801f6f9b64289c105f1c5e74804:0
  • value  2499531
    address  3MDkkdtEvhFxGMmFbHF14EFbGSaNUtkcwm
  • 76754123725ed883f3a6dff7ede48bd71691c801f6f9b64289c105f1c5e74804:1
  • value  1002109
    address  3EPpKrZZ5trrFoBf9Wp9gCi55iJBt6ZKmH